A Nigerian lady has shared an emotional online tribute following the death of Nollywood actor Alexx Ekubo, revealing a private side of the star that many never saw before his passing. The post on X, under the handle @itohan_olat, described how Ekubo deliberately shielded his illness from the public, choosing to be remembered as strong rather than frail.
Lady Speaks on Alexx Ekubo's Final Moments
In her heartfelt message, the lady noted that there are no sick or weak photos of Ekubo online. She said he made a conscious choice to face his battle with cancer privately, away from cameras and public scrutiny. Her words moved many Nigerians, who praised the actor for his dignity and strength during a difficult time.
She wrote: "There are no sick or frail photos of him online. He made a conscious choice not to let the world see him weak or unwell. He faced it privately and left as the strong man he wanted to be remembered as. Rip Alex Ekubo. This one pain me."

Legacy of Privacy and Strength
Ekubo's decision to keep his illness private has been widely respected. Many noted that he maintained control over his narrative, ensuring his legacy remains one of talent and resilience rather than suffering. The actor's death has prompted widespread mourning across social media, with fans, friends, and family paying tribute to his life and career.
